AngularJS ng-repeat inside ng-if

  1. <!DOCTYPE html>  
  2. <html>  
  3.   
  4. <head>  
  5.     <title></title>  
  6.     <meta charset="utf-8" />  
  7.     <script src="Scripts/angular.js"></script>  
  8.     <script>  
  9.         var app = angular.module('app', []);  
  10.         app.controller("MyCtrl", function($scope)   
  11.             {  
  12.             $scope.selection =   
  13.               {  
  14.                 ids:   
  15.               {  
  16.                     "50d5ad"true  
  17.                 }  
  18.             };  
  19.             $scope.categories = [  
  20.               {  
  21.                 "name""Sport",  
  22.                 "id""50d5ad"  
  23.             },   
  24.               {  
  25.                 "name""General",  
  26.                 "id""678ffr"  
  27.             }];  
  28.         })  
  29.     </script>  
  30. </head>  
  31.   
  32. <body ng-app="app">  
  33.     <div ng-controller="MyCtrl">  
  34.         <div ng-repeat="data in categories">  
  35.             <div ng-if="data.name == 'Sport' ">  
  36.                 {{data.name}}  
  37.             </div>  
  38.         </div>  
  39.     </div>  
  40. </body>  
  41.   
  42. </html>